The bus between Banbury and Daventry takes 58 min. The bus service runs several times per day from Banbury to Daventry.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.
Buses run every 4 hours between Banbury and Daventry. The earliest departure is at 7:25 AM in the morning, and the last departure from Banbury is at 5:35 PM which arrives into Daventry at 6:33 PM. All services run direct with no transfers required, and take on average 58 min.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.
